Mandatory Safety Assessments

A cornerstone of the new regulations is the requirement for mandatory safety assessments before AVs can be tested on public roads. These assessments must evaluate the AV’s ability to handle various driving scenarios, including emergency situations, adverse weather conditions, and interactions with other vehicles and pedestrians.

Enhanced Data Reporting

The new regulations also mandate enhanced data reporting requirements for AV testing. Manufacturers must now collect and report detailed data on all testing activities, including information on accidents, near-misses, and system failures. This data will be used to identify potential safety issues and track the performance of AV technology over time.

Liability in Case of Accidents

One of the most pressing ethical considerations is determining liability in the event of an accident involving an AV. Should the manufacturer, the owner, or the AV itself be held responsible? The new regulations seek to clarify these issues by establishing clear lines of accountability and insurance requirements.

Data Privacy

AVs collect vast amounts of data about their surroundings and occupants, raising concerns about data privacy. The new regulations aim to protect individuals’ privacy by requiring manufacturers to implement robust data security measures and obtain informed consent before collecting and using personal data.

Algorithmic Bias

Algorithmic bias is another significant ethical concern. AVs rely on complex algorithms to make decisions, and these algorithms can be biased based on the data they are trained on. The new regulations encourage manufacturers to address algorithmic bias by ensuring that their algorithms are fair, transparent, and accountable.
